Nota:
El acceso a esta página requiere autorización. Puede intentar iniciar sesión o cambiar directorios.
El acceso a esta página requiere autorización. Puede intentar cambiar los directorios.
Comprueba si una ventana especificada es compatible con entrada táctil y, opcionalmente, recupera las marcas modificadores establecidas para la funcionalidad táctil de la ventana.
Sintaxis
BOOL IsTouchWindow(
[in] HWND hwnd,
[out, optional] PULONG pulFlags
);
Parámetros
[in] hwnd
Controlador de la ventana. La función produce un error con ERROR_ACCESS_DENIED si el subproceso que realiza la llamada no está en el mismo escritorio que la ventana especificada.
[out, optional] pulFlags
Dirección de la variable ULONG para recibir las marcas modificadores de la funcionalidad táctil de la ventana especificada.
Valor devuelto
Devuelve TRUE si la ventana admite Windows Touch; devuelve FALSE si la ventana no admite Windows Touch.
Comentarios
En la tabla siguiente se enumeran los valores del parámetro de salida pulFlags .
| Marca | Descripción |
|---|---|
| TWF_FINETOUCH | Especifica que hWnd prefiere la entrada táctil no codificada. |
| TWF_WANTPALM |
Al borrar esta marca, se deshabilita el rechazo de la palma, lo que reduce los retrasos para obtener mensajes de WM_TOUCH .
Esto es útil si desea una respuesta lo más rápida posible cuando un usuario toca la aplicación.
Al establecer esta marca, se habilita la detección de palma y se impedirá que algunos mensajes de WM_TOUCH se envíen a la aplicación. Esto es útil si no desea recibir WM_TOUCH mensajes de contacto de palma. |
Requisitos
| Requisito | Value |
|---|---|
| Cliente mínimo compatible | Windows 7 [solo aplicaciones de escritorio] |
| Servidor mínimo compatible | Windows Server 2008 R2 [solo aplicaciones de escritorio] |
| Plataforma de destino | Windows |
| Encabezado | winuser.h (incluya Windows.h) |
| Library | User32.lib |
| Archivo DLL | User32.dll |
| Conjunto de API | ext-ms-win-ntuser-misc-l1-2-0 (introducido en Windows 8.1) |